Adam Lallana has reportedly convinced former Liverpool teammate James Milner to join Premier League top-four rivals Brighton & Hove Albion.

According to a report by Football Insider, Adam Lallana has played a crucial role in convincing James Milner to join Brighton & Hove Albion. The veteran midfielder is on the verge of leaving Liverpool as a free agent. And he will likely join the Reds’ Premier League top-four rivals in the summer transfer window.

James Milner has carved a lasting legacy since joining Liverpool from Manchester City in July 2015. The Reds were not top-four regulars when the 37-year-old left the Citizens. But he has played a pivotal role in the Merseyside club’s ascent as one of the best teams in the Premier League.

The Englishman has turned out over 300 times for Liverpool, chipping in with 26 goals and 46 assists. Milner has won every trophy with Liverpool while reprising almost every role for the club. But the veteran midfielder’s Liverpool contract ends in the summer. And he will likely leave as a free agent to join Premier League top-four rivals Brighton & Hove Albion.

The Seagulls have come leaps and bounds since securing promotion to the Premier League nearly half a dozen years ago. And they are now one of the contenders to secure a top-four finish this season. Roberto De Zerbi, in particular, has galvanised Brighton, who should secure European qualification this term.

Embed from Getty Images

But Brighton & Hove Albion are in danger of losing some of their top players this summer. Alexis Mac Allister, in particular, is a top target for several clubs, with Liverpool closing in on securing his services. And De Zerbi wants the South Coast club to bolster the midfield unit, with Milner emerging as a target.

Recent reports have claimed that Milner wants to join Brighton in the summer transfer window. And according to Football Insider, former Liverpool midfielder Adam Lallana has played a crucial role in convincing the veteran midfielder.

The 34-year-old previously spent several years with Liverpool before joining Brighton. And Lallana has found a second wind since moving to the Amex Stadium. Plus, with Brighton becoming a top-half club, Milner can potentially end his glittering career with a solid stint with the Seagulls.
